The right Marathi distribution captures year-round streams plus the major Ganesh Chaturthi opportunity together.<\/span><\/p>\n<h2><b>Marathi Music Sub-Segments<\/b><\/h2>\n<h3><b>Sub-Segment 1: Marathi Film Music<\/b><\/h3>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Marathi cinema has grown significantly in commercial impact since 2010, with multiple Marathi films achieving box office success and producing memorable soundtracks. Marathi film music distribution often happens through film production companies, but independent artists releasing Marathi film-style music or having film connections operate in this commercially significant space. Production typically matches contemporary Marathi cinema aesthetics. Strong caller tune adoption for film music hits.<\/span><\/p>\n<h3><b>Sub-Segment 2: Marathi Indie<\/b><\/h3>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Independent Marathi music outside film context. Growing scene centered in Mumbai and Pune. Marathi indie pop, alternative, electronic, and folk-fusion experimentation. Strong on Spotify Marathi indie editorial. Less caller tune relevance for Western-influenced Marathi indie versus stronger relevance for traditional Marathi-themed indie. Geographic concentration in Mumbai and Pune with an emerging presence elsewhere in Maharashtra.<\/span><\/p>\n<h3><b>Sub-Segment 3: Marathi Rap and Hip-Hop<\/b><\/h3>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Marathi rap is an emerging scene with growing visibility. Marathi rap follows some patterns similar to broader Indian rap distribution covered in our <\/span><a href=\"https:\/\/theblackturn.com\/blogs\/music-distribution-rappers-india\/\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">rapper distribution guide<\/span><\/a><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">. Combines streaming, YouTube, and modest caller tune adoption. Marathi rap audience overlaps significantly with Marathi indie scene.<\/span><\/p>\n<h3><b>Sub-Segment 4: Marathi Folk &#8211; Lavani and Powada<\/b><\/h3>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Lavani is the distinctive Marathi folk dance music tradition with strong cultural identity. Powada is the heroic ballad tradition celebrating historical figures and events. Both have dedicated audiences particularly in interior Maharashtra and among diaspora communities preserving cultural heritage. JioSaavn Marathi folk categories. YouTube traditional music ecosystem. Caller tune adoption is moderate to strong for celebratory Lavani-influenced tracks.<\/span><\/p>\n<h3><b>Sub-Segment 5: Marathi Devotional and Abhang<\/b><\/h3>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Marathi devotional music includes abhangs (devotional songs to Lord Vitthal\/Pandurang of Pandharpur), Ganesh aartis, Datta devotional, and various deity-specific devotional music. Strong caller tune adoption following devotional music patterns covered in our <\/span><a href=\"https:\/\/theblackturn.com\/blogs\/music-distribution-devotional-artists-india\/\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">devotional artist distribution guide<\/span><\/a><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">. Ganesh aarti consumption spikes massively during Ganesh Chaturthi creating a unique 11-day revenue window.<\/span><\/p>\n<h2><b>Where Marathi Music Actually Earns<\/b><\/h2>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Honest revenue stream breakdown for typical Marathi independent artists in 2026:<\/span><\/p>\n<table>\n<tbody>\n<tr>\n<td><b>Revenue Stream<\/b><\/td>\n<td><b>Approx Share<\/b><\/td>\n<td><b>Notes<\/b><\/td>\n<\/tr>\n<tr>\n<td><b>Streaming (JioSaavn + Spotify + Apple)<\/b><\/td>\n<td><b>30-45%<\/b><\/td>\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Strong Mumbai\/Pune streaming base. Year-round for devotional and traditional<\/span><\/td>\n<\/tr>\n<tr>\n<td><b>Marathi diaspora streaming<\/b><\/td>\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">5-15%<\/span><\/td>\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">US, UK, Australia, Gulf &#8211; smaller than Tamil\/Telugu but present<\/span><\/td>\n<\/tr>\n<tr>\n<td><b>Instagram audio<\/b><\/td>\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">3-8%<\/span><\/td>\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Growing Marathi Reels usage particularly for Marathi indie and dance<\/span><\/td>\n<\/tr>\n<tr>\n<td><b>Sync placements<\/b><\/td>\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Variable<\/span><\/td>\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Marathi films, Marathi web series, regional ads, Marathi OTT content<\/span><\/td>\n<\/tr>\n<\/tbody>\n<\/table>\n<p>&nbsp;<\/p>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">For complete data on Indian music revenue patterns across regional genres, see our <\/span><a href=\"https:\/\/theblackturn.com\/research\/state-of-indian-independent-music-2026\/\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">State of Indian Independent Music 2026 data study<\/span><\/a><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">.<\/span><\/p>\n<h2><b>The Ganesh Chaturthi Opportunity (Unique to Marathi)<\/b><\/h2>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Among all Indian festivals and cultural moments, Ganesh Chaturthi creates the longest sustained music consumption window. Where Diwali is 1 day, Holi is 1 day, and most festivals are single-day or two-day events, Ganesh Chaturthi runs 11 full days from Bhadrapad Shukla Chaturthi (Ganesh installation) through Anant Chaturdashi (Ganesh visarjan). Throughout these 11 days, Marathi music consumption spikes dramatically:<\/span><\/p>\n<ul>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>Caller tune adoption<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> spikes for Ganesh aartis, Ganpati bhajans, and Marathi devotional songs across all 4 telecom networks<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>Streaming consumption<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> of Marathi devotional and Ganesh-themed playlists peaks across JioSaavn, Spotify, Apple Music<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>YouTube views<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> for Ganesh aartis (Sukhkarta Dukhharta and others) reach festival-level numbers<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>Content ID earnings<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> from massive Ganesh celebration video uploads, household pooja recordings, and community celebration documentation<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>Sync opportunities<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> for Marathi advertisements, Ganesh-themed content on OTT, and community celebration content<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>Live performance demand<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> for Marathi artists (outside distribution scope but worth noting)<\/span><\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<h3><b>Maximizing Ganesh Chaturthi Through Strategic Release Timing<\/b><\/h3>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Marathi artists who release strategically around Ganesh Chaturthi see substantial seasonal revenue uplifts. The strategic approach:<\/span><\/p>\n<ol>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>Identify Ganesh Chaturthi dates 6 months ahead<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> (typically late August or early September each year)<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>Plan Ganesh-themed releases for 3-4 weeks before festival start<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> to enable editorial pitching<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>Release Ganesh aartis, Ganpati bhajans, Marathi devotional tracks<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> that align with festival music consumption<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>Pitch to Spotify Ganesh Chaturthi specific playlists<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> through Spotify for Artists<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>Pitch JioSaavn Marathi devotional and Ganesh categories<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> in parallel<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>Coordinate social media promotion<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> during the 11-day festival window for maximum visibility<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>Activate Content ID early<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> to monetize Ganesh celebration video uploads<\/span><\/li>\n<\/ol>\n<p><b>The math of Ganesh Chaturthi: <\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">A successful Marathi Ganesh-themed release can earn in 11 days what year-round content earns over multiple months. The combination of caller tune adoption spike, streaming consumption peak, YouTube views, and Content ID monetization during this window creates the largest concentrated revenue opportunity in the Marathi music calendar. Artists who release 1-2 Ganesh-themed tracks each year alongside their regular catalog often see Ganesh Chaturthi revenue rival or exceed other quarters.<\/span><\/p>\n<h2><b>Marathi Festival and Cultural Release Timing<\/b><\/h2>\n<table>\n<tbody>\n<tr>\n<td><b>Marathi Festival<\/b><\/td>\n<td><b>Timing<\/b><\/td>\n<td><b>Music Type<\/b><\/td>\n<\/tr>\n<tr>\n<td><b>Makar Sankranti<\/b><\/td>\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">January 14<\/span><\/td>\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Harvest songs, traditional Marathi music<\/span><\/td>\n<\/tr>\n<tr>\n<td><b>Gudi Padwa<\/b><\/td>\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">March\/April<\/span><\/td>\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Marathi New Year, celebratory and traditional music<\/span><\/td>\n<\/tr>\n<tr>\n<td><b>Holi\/Rangpanchami<\/b><\/td>\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">March<\/span><\/td>\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Holi songs, Marathi versions of Krishna devotional<\/span><\/td>\n<\/tr>\n<tr>\n<td><b>Maha Shivratri<\/b><\/td>\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Feb\/March<\/span><\/td>\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Marathi Shiv bhajans, Shiv devotional<\/span><\/td>\n<\/tr>\n<tr>\n<td><b>Pandharpur Wari<\/b><\/td>\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">July<\/span><\/td>\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Abhang music, Vitthal devotional, pilgrimage songs<\/span><\/td>\n<\/tr>\n<tr>\n<td><b>Nag Panchami<\/b><\/td>\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">July\/August<\/span><\/td>\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Traditional Marathi folk songs<\/span><\/td>\n<\/tr>\n<tr>\n<td><b>Ganesh Chaturthi (11 days)<\/b><\/td>\n<td><b>Aug\/Sept<\/b><\/td>\n<td><b>Ganesh aartis, Ganpati bhajans, Marathi devotional &#8211; LARGEST opportunity<\/b><\/td>\n<\/tr>\n<tr>\n<td><b>Navratri<\/b><\/td>\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Sept\/Oct<\/span><\/td>\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Devi devotional, traditional Marathi celebration<\/span><\/td>\n<\/tr>\n<tr>\n<td><b>Dasara\/Vijayadashami<\/b><\/td>\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Sept\/Oct<\/span><\/td>\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Victory celebration music<\/span><\/td>\n<\/tr>\n<tr>\n<td><b>Diwali<\/b><\/td>\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Oct\/Nov<\/span><\/td>\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Festive Marathi music, family-oriented releases<\/span><\/td>\n<\/tr>\n<tr>\n<td><b>Tulsi Vivah<\/b><\/td>\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Nov<\/span><\/td>\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Traditional Marathi devotional<\/span><\/td>\n<\/tr>\n<\/tbody>\n<\/table>\n<p>&nbsp;<\/p>\n<h2><b>Marathi Music Distribution Comparison<\/b><\/h2>\n<table>\n<tbody>\n<tr>\n<td><b>Distributor<\/b><\/td>\n<td><b>Caller Tune (4 networks)<\/b><\/td>\n<td><b>Spotify Marathi<\/b><\/td>\n<td><b>JioSaavn Marathi<\/b><\/td>\n<td><b>INR<\/b><\/td>\n<\/tr>\n<tr>\n<td><b>The Black Turn<\/b><\/td>\n<td><b>Yes<\/b><\/td>\n<td><b>Yes<\/b><\/td>\n<td><b>Native<\/b><\/td>\n<td><b>Yes<\/b><\/td>\n<\/tr>\n<tr>\n<td><b>DistroKid<\/b><\/td>\n<td><b>No<\/b><\/td>\n<td><b>Yes<\/b><\/td>\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Via partners<\/span><\/td>\n<td><b>No<\/b><\/td>\n<\/tr>\n<tr>\n<td><b>TuneCore<\/b><\/td>\n<td><b>No<\/b><\/td>\n<td><b>Yes<\/b><\/td>\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Via partners<\/span><\/td>\n<td><b>No<\/b><\/td>\n<\/tr>\n<tr>\n<td><b>CD Baby<\/b><\/td>\n<td><b>No<\/b><\/td>\n<td><b>Yes<\/b><\/td>\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Via partners<\/span><\/td>\n<td><b>No<\/b><\/td>\n<\/tr>\n<tr>\n<td><b>RouteNote Free<\/b><\/td>\n<td><b>No<\/b><\/td>\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Limited<\/span><\/td>\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Via partners<\/span><\/td>\n<td><b>No<\/b><\/td>\n<\/tr>\n<tr>\n<td><b>Amuse Free<\/b><\/td>\n<td><b>No<\/b><\/td>\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Limited<\/span><\/td>\n<td><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Via partners<\/span><\/td>\n<td><b>No<\/b><\/td>\n<\/tr>\n<\/tbody>\n<\/table>\n<p>&nbsp;<\/p>\n<h2><b>Ranked Best Distribution for Marathi Artists<\/b><\/h2>\n<h3><b>1.
